Corten steel also called cor ten steel is a weathering steel that resists corrosion but is not rust proof.

The cost of installing metal siding will vary by material but installing steel horizontal siding for a 1 500 square foot house will cost 5 10 per square foot or 7 500 15 000.
Metal siding costs 2 04 to 9 60 per square foot for just the materials or 3 50 to 9 50 per square foot installed.
The corten steel price per square foot falls in the range of 2 5 to 3 although that excludes the cost of working with siding contractors to have it properly installed.
